Merge tag 'cxl-for-6.10'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/cxl/cxl
Pull CXL updates from Dave Jiang: - Three CXL mailbox passthrough commands are added to support the populating and clearing of vendor debug logs: - Get Log Capabilities - Get Supported Log Sub-List Commands - Clear Log - Add support of Device Phyiscal Address (DPA) to Host Physical Address (HPA) translation for CXL events of cxl_dram and cxl_general media. This allows user space to figure out which CXL region the event occured via trace event. - Connect CXL to CPER reporting. If a device is configured for firmware first, CXL event records are not sent directly to the host. Those records are reported through EFI Common Platform Error Records (CPER). Add support to route the CPER records through the CXL sub-system in order to provide DPA to HPA translation and also event decoding and tracing. -static bool cxl_is_hpa_in_range(u64 hpa, struct cxl_region *cxlr, int pos)
-{
- struct cxl_region_params *p = &cxlr->params;
- int gran = p->interleave_granularity;
- int ways = p->interleave_ways;
- u64 offset;
-
- /* Is the hpa within this region at all */
- if (hpa < p->res->start || hpa > p->res->end) {
- dev_dbg(&cxlr->dev,
- "Addr trans fail: hpa 0x%llx not in region\n", hpa);
- return false;
- }
-
- /* Is the hpa in an expected chunk for its pos(-ition) */
- offset = hpa - p->res->start;
- offset = do_div(offset, gran * ways);
- if ((offset >= pos * gran) && (offset < (pos + 1) * gran))
- return true;
-
- dev_dbg(&cxlr->dev,
- "Addr trans fail: hpa 0x%llx not in expected chunk\n", hpa);
-
- return false;
-}
-
-static u64 cxl_dpa_to_hpa(u64 dpa, struct cxl_region *cxlr,
- struct cxl_endpoint_decoder *cxled)
-{
- u64 dpa_offset, hpa_offset, bits_upper, mask_upper, hpa;
- struct cxl_region_params *p = &cxlr->params;
- int pos = cxled->pos;
- u16 eig = 0;
- u8 eiw = 0;
-
- ways_to_eiw(p->interleave_ways, &eiw);
- granularity_to_eig(p->interleave_granularity, &eig);
-
- /*
- * The device position in the region interleave set was removed
- * from the offset at HPA->DPA translation. To reconstruct the
- * HPA, place the 'pos' in the offset.
- *
- * The placement of 'pos' in the HPA is determined by interleave
- * ways and granularity and is defined in the CXL Spec 3.0 Section
- * 8.2.4.19.13 Implementation Note: Device Decode Logic
- */
-
- /* Remove the dpa base */
- dpa_offset = dpa - cxl_dpa_resource_start(cxled);
-
- mask_upper = GENMASK_ULL(51, eig + 8);
-
- if (eiw < 8) {
- hpa_offset = (dpa_offset & mask_upper) << eiw;
- hpa_offset |= pos << (eig + 8);
- } else {
- bits_upper = (dpa_offset & mask_upper) >> (eig + 8);
- bits_upper = bits_upper * 3;
- hpa_offset = ((bits_upper << (eiw - 8)) + pos) << (eig + 8);
- }
-
- /* The lower bits remain unchanged */
- hpa_offset |= dpa_offset & GENMASK_ULL(eig + 7, 0);
-
- /* Apply the hpa_offset to the region base address */
- hpa = hpa_offset + p->res->start;
-
- if (!cxl_is_hpa_in_range(hpa, cxlr, cxled->pos))
- return ULLONG_MAX;
-
- return hpa;
-}
